Section 15 | Collective community charge.
From legislation.gov.uk
(1)If a person is entered in an authority’s register as subject in a chargeable financial year to a collective community charge of the authority, he shall be liable to pay to the authority an amount in respect of the charge as it has effect for the year.
(2)The amount shall be found by deducting amount B from amount A.
(3)Amount A is the aggregate of the amounts payable (and whether or not paid) to the person by way of contribution to the amount he is liable to pay to the authority in respect of the charge as it has effect for the year.
(4)Amount B is an amount equal to the relevant proportion of amount A; and the relevant proportion is 5 per cent. or such other proportion as may be prescribed by the Secretary of State by order.
